How much does it cost to rent a home in Sunrise?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Sunrise 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,166 | $1,495 | $3,500 |
| Sunrise 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,191 | $1,400 | $6,200 |
| Sunrise 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$4,473 | $2,750 | $9,990 |
| Sunrise 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$6,173 | $3,750 | $10,000+ |
| Sunrise 7 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$12,895 | $10,000 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about Sunrise
What type of rentals are currently available in Sunrise?
There are currently 522 Apartments for Rent in Sunrise, FL with pricing that ranges from $850 to $8,998. There are also 621 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Sunrise ranging from $600 to $21,995.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Sunrise?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Sunrise ranges from $600 to $21,995 with an average monthly rent of $8,021.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Sunrise?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Sunrise range from $2,325 to $5,239,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,400 to $6,200.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$2,750 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$6,940.
